Output 5837426a99726c23d8659aa2df6c11190828fbeb31a7e732a412b99295c1688a:4

value
2592260
script pubkey
OP_0 OP_PUSHBYTES_20 3d5ee954b90248917d6a20d90f207c0e03b521ae
address
bc1q840wj49eqfyfzlt2yrvs7grupcpm2gdwvv2wmu
transaction
5837426a99726c23d8659aa2df6c11190828fbeb31a7e732a412b99295c1688a
spent
true